RPL Series Gripper is a pneumatic parallel gripper with excellent parallelism and accuracy between the gripper mounting surface and jaw surface. Jaws are front mounted and are supported with 'Dual-V' roller bearings to provide low friction motion and are preloaded for maximum support and zero side play. This gripper supports longer finger length designs compared to other grippers of similar sizes. These grippers are available in stroke lengths from 6.4 to 19.1mm (0.25 to 0.75') with a grip force from 116 to 160 N (26 to 36 lbs).

Linear motion pneumatic components are double acting cylinders that require a dry air supply with filtering to 40 microns or better. For best control of pneumatic components, flow control valves (regulating out) should be installed to regulate the speed of the device. Position sensors can easily be added to motion components to detect the end of travel positions of the slides, they are the standard method of communication with the PLC and are available in inductive or magneto resistive sensing styles and come in both PNP or NPN sourcing signals.

TECHNICAL SPECIFICATIONS
Pneumatic Specifications
    Pressure Operating Range: 0.3 to 7 bar(5 to 100 psi)
    Cylinder Type: Dual double acting
    Dynamic Seals: Internally lubricated Buna-N
    Valve Required to Operate: 4-way, 2-position
Air Quality Requirements
    Air Filtration: 40 micron or better
    Air Lubrication: Not necessary*
    Air Humidity: Low moisture content (dry)
Temperature Operating Range
    Buna-N Seals (Standard): -35 to 80°C(-30 to 180°F)
    FKMSeals (Optional): -30 to 120°C(-20 to 250°F)
Maintenance Specifications
Expected Life:
    Normal Application: 5 million cycles
    With Preventative Maintenance: 10+ million cycles*
Field Repairable: Yes
Seal Repair Kits Available: Yes *Addition of lubrication will greatly increase service life.
